DD is 13 soon and loves reading. The last couple of years I have successfully found books for her that have become her favourites so I’m under pressure to find her something new! However while she’s a really good reader she doesn’t want to read typically YA books - she doesn’t really feel ready to move on to those yet. If I list some of her favourites does anyone have any ideas I could look at for her? She loves:

Murder Most Unladylike
Ruby Redfort
Lottie Brooks series
Geek Girl series
Matilda
Ballet Shoes

She seems to like funny diary style books about girls around her age who don’t quite fit in so any suggestions in that vein would be good. She also likes mysteries. She’s read a lot of the classics.

A Girl Called Justice by Elly Griffiths, there are 3 more in the series beyond that.

Set in a boarding school, the daughter of a judge investigates a murder that happens at the school, snowed in and having to deal with things within the school.
